Recognizing Common Refrigerator Troubles



Fridges are essential in keeping your food fresh, yet they can come across a series of usual issues that interrupt their performance. One constant problem is poor cooling. If you observe food ruining quicker than common, examine the thermostat settings or take into consideration if the door seals are harmed. Another usual trouble is too much noise, which can show a malfunctioning compressor or a failing follower. You may additionally experience water merging inside or below the fridge; this usually arises from a blocked defrost drain or a malfunctioning water line. Additionally, if your refrigerator's light isn't functioning, it could be a basic bulb issue or a trouble with the door button. Ultimately, ice buildup in the fridge freezer can hinder air movement and cooling performance. Identifying these issues early can save you money and time out of commission, ensuring your refrigerator runs smoothly and effectively.

Tidy Condenser Coils Consistently



Cleansing your condenser coils routinely can significantly improve your appliance's efficiency. Dust and dirt accumulate on these coils gradually, triggering your home appliance to function more challenging and take in even more energy. To maintain them clean, unplug your home appliance and meticulously eliminate any type of safety covers. Utilize a vacuum with a brush attachment or a soft brush to delicately eliminate debris. If needed, a blend of cozy water and mild detergent can help get rid of persistent crud. Ensure to allow everything completely dry completely prior to rebuilding and plugging the home appliance back in. Purpose to cleanse your coils at the very least two times a year, or regularly if you have animals or live in a dusty setting. This simple job can expand the life expectancy of your home appliance significantly.




Check Door Seals





3 basic actions can assist you guarantee your home appliance's door seals are in good problem. First, evaluate the seals regularly for any type of cracks, rips, or indications of wear. These damages can bring about air leakages, influencing effectiveness. 2nd, tidy the seals using cozy, soapy water to get rid of any kind of debris or crud. A tidy seal guarantees a tight fit and better efficiency. Ultimately, carry out a basic test by shutting the door on a paper. If you can quickly pull it out without resistance, the seal could require changing. By complying with these steps, you'll maintain your device's effectiveness and durability, saving you cash on power bills and repair services over time.




Monitor Temperature Level Settings



Frequently monitoring your appliance's temperature level setups is necessary for best performance and efficiency. Whether you're handling a refrigerator, freezer, or oven, maintaining an eye on these settings can avoid several issues. For fridges, goal for temperatures in between 35 ° F and 38 ° F; for fridges freezer, remain 0 ° F. If the temperature levels are too high or reduced, your appliance may work harder, losing power and reducing its life expectancy. Make use of a thermostat to inspect these setups regularly, especially after major modifications, like moving your appliance or changing the thermostat. If you observe variations, readjust the settings appropriately and speak with the user handbook for advice. By remaining aggressive concerning temperature level surveillance, you'll guarantee your appliances run efficiently and last much longer.




Troubleshooting Cooling Issues



When your fridge isn't cooling effectively, it can lead to spoiled food and threw away cash, so addressing the problem without delay is important. Start by checking the temperature setups to verify they go to the suggested degrees, typically around 37 ° F for the refrigerator and 0 ° F for the freezer. If the setups are appropriate, examine the door seals for any type of voids or damage; a faulty seal can enable cozy air to enter.


Examine the condenser coils, generally located at the back or base of the system. Tidy them with a vacuum cleaner or brush to optimize performance. If troubles linger, it might be time to call an expert.

Identify Leak Resources



Just how can you efficiently determine the sources of water leak and ice accumulation in your devices? Beginning by checking the seals and gaskets on your fridge and freezer doors. A worn or broken seal can enable cozy air to get in, causing condensation and ice. Next, examine the drainpipe frying pan and drainage system for blockages or obstructions; a backed-up drain can cause water merging. Look for any type of loose connections in the water system line, which can produce leaks. Likewise, take a look at the defrost drain for ice buildup, which might disrupt proper drain. By methodically checking these locations, you'll pinpoint the source of the problem, enabling you to take the required steps to fix it and prolong your device's life-span.

How Usually Should I Tidy the Fridge Coils?



You ought to cleanse your fridge coils every 6 months. This assists preserve efficiency and prevents overheating. If you notice extreme dirt or animal hair, clean them more often to assure your fridge runs efficiently.

What Temperature Should My Fridge Be Set To?



You need to set your fridge to 37 ° F(3 ° C) for optimal food preservation. This temperature level maintains your food fresh while avoiding spoilage, guaranteeing your grocery stores last longer and reducing waste. It's a simple adjustment you can make!




Does a Refrigerator Required to Be Leveled?



Yes, your fridge needs to be leveled. If it's irregular, it can impact cooling efficiency and trigger excess sound. Inspect the leveling legs and change them to guarantee proper balance for perfect efficiency.




How Can I Minimize Refrigerator Power Intake?



To lower your fridge's power consumption, maintain it tidy and well-ventilated, check door seals for leaks, established the temperature level between 35-38 ° F, and avoid overwhelming it. These steps can significantly decrease your power bills.
